Giới thiệu dự án
Đây là website quản lý chi tiêu cá nhân được xây dựng bằng ASP.NET Core MVC trên nền tảng .NET 8. Hệ thống sử dụng Entity Framework Core theo mô hình Code First và tích hợp Identity để hỗ trợ các chức năng đăng nhập, đăng ký, đổi mật khẩu và quản lý thông tin người dùng.
Website cho phép người dùng quản lý thu chi hàng ngày thông qua các danh mục, theo dõi các khoản chi tiêu. Giao diện dễ sử dụng, logic rõ ràng, phù hợp cho các bạn sinh viên làm đồ án môn học hoặc báo cáo cuối kỳ.
Chức năng chính
-
Đăng ký, đăng nhập, đăng xuất bằng ASP.NET Core Identity
-
Quên mật khẩu và đặt lại mật khẩu qua email
-
Quản lý thông tin cá nhân và đổi mật khẩu
-
Quản lý danh mục thu và chi (thêm, sửa, xóa)
-
Thêm và chỉnh sửa giao dịch chi tiêu hàng ngày
Công nghệ sử dụng
Cấu trúc dự án
-
Controllers: Chứa các controller như Account, Categories, Transactions, Statistics…
-
Models: Các model như Category, Transaction, ApplicationUser…
-
Views: Giao diện Razor chia theo từng chức năng
-
Areas/Identity: Toàn bộ hệ thống trang đăng nhập và quản lý tài khoản
-
Data: ApplicationDbContext và cấu hình EF Core
-
Migrations: Toàn bộ các migration tạo database
XEM THÊM ==> Hướng dẫn cài đặt chi tiết
Nguồn: Sharecode.vn